You get what you pay for.
1. You get what you pay for. Don't expect a fully upgraded luxury apt if your rent is under 1k a month near the downtown area. Some ppl just like to complain about unrealistic expectations.
2. I was there for 2 years and there were 3 new landlords/building managers in that time frame
3. It's an old building so be prepared for mice! They say they've handled it but between ppl dumping their trash right outside the gate and old building structure you're bound to see more than one during your... lease. The maintenance folks will put traps down but it doesn't really help plus they take FOREVER to bring you any. There will be RATS running rapid outside the building every night be aware (again because of dumped trash)
4. Maintenance team is HORRIBLE! At one point my outlets didn't work expect in the bathroom and by the entry door so I couldn't use any major appliances or my router and they took a MONTH to fix it. They don't address any major issues quick enough unless you attach photos/vid. And even then it's a long shot. Personally I think they just wait for the tenant to end their lease to do any real updating. My fridge was leaking pretty much my entire time living there.
5. They finally put security cameras up because the rise in loitering from strangers somehow entering the building.
6. Communication with the building manager is terrible. The latest one never answered emails or acted like you didn't send requested information over and over again.
7. Laundry facility is fine but there's only 2 sets of WD and it's coin laundry with no machine down there to break bills. So basically have a $3 worth of quarters on you at all times or just go to a laundromat.
8. Besides a lot of bad parts of this building overall for it's location and size it's a decent starter apt. Like I said, don't expect luxury for the price. But location and price is what gave this 2 stars

The antoinette
I haven't even moved in yet and it's by far the best apartment experience I have had. I've been searching around for quite a while, and it's located in a decent neighborhood for the area. It's only about a block or two away from campus, and campus security patrols only one block prior, so it's still pretty secure. Templetown realty takes care of heat and water, so it's a pretty good bargain, and rent is pretty low. From what I hear construction to the building next door once damaged it , causing... prior remnants to move out, but despite that most of them renewed their lease for when the building is up and running again. This sounds like a true testament to the building's quality, and tenants' overall experiences.
